August 30, 2019 Review of: ZaHa El Corte Malbec/ Cabernet Sauvignon Blend

8.5/10 $24.95 ZaHa El Corte Malbec/Cabernet Sauvignon Blend 2014 (Argentina). Deep ruby in colour. Extra Dry and medium bodied, with medium tannins and good notable acidity. Flavours of soft oak 🌳, blackberry, dark cherry πŸ’and smoke πŸ’¨.
From the get-go this bottle packed a dense yet smooth glass, making for a unique and enjoyable experience on its own. The finish was lengthy, and I would recommend consuming with food to balance out the lingering bitterness from the tannins. (Of course, there are some winos who I’m sure really enjoy this characteristic, but it’s my recommendation for anyone else less seasoned). A medium rare cut of meat πŸ₯©would just be perfection πŸ‘ŒπŸ»with this.
Overall, I do think the β€œ96 points” as indicated on the bottle is a little generous… but this is definitely a nice blend that is sure to impress the red wine lover in your life!
